When purchasing a new treadmill, numerous essential features ought to be thought about:
Motor Power (HP): A more powerful motor (at least 2.5 HP) is vital for running and for users who plan to utilize the treadmill regularly.
Running Surface: Consider the size of the belt. A longer and larger running surface can accommodate longer strides and provides much better security.
Incline Options: Adjustable incline can include intensity to exercises and target different muscle groups.
Workout Programs: Many treadmills provide integrated exercise programs that can guide users through different workouts and regimens.
Show Features: A clear display allows users to track their speed, distance, calories burned, and heart rate more easily.
Cushioning: Adequate shock absorption can lower the danger of injury and provide a more comfortable running experience.
Innovation Integration: Features like Bluetooth connectivity, mobile app integration, and integrated speakers can boost the exercise experience.
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)Q1: How much should I budget for a treadmill?
A: Budget can differ based upon functions and quality. Manual treadmills start around ₤ 100, while motorized designs can range from ₤ 500 to ₤ 3,000, depending upon advanced features.
Q2: How often should I maintain my treadmill?

Q3: Can I slim down with a treadmill?
A: Yes, routine use of the treadmill, combined with a healthy diet, can help with weight reduction. Integrating interval training increases intensity and calorie burn.
Q4: Is it much better to work on a treadmill or outdoors?
A: Both have advantages. Treadmills supply a controlled environment and cushioning, while outside running offers varied scenery and natural inclines.
Q5: Do I need unique shoes for utilizing a treadmill?
A: While specific treadmill shoes aren't needed, using good-quality running shoes created for support, cushioning, and stability is suggested.
